Editorial Reviews

Amazon.co.uk Review
First issued in 1965, few recordings have lasted so well and, in the case of Sea Pictures, carried on getting better. Du Pré's account of the concerto, made when she was barely 20, made her a star overnight and remains the work with which she's most often identified. Her forceful, highly emotional performance won't be to all tastes or occasions but it brings the work to life like few others. Not just the poignancy of the opening or the aching nostalgia of the "Adagio" but the quicksilver brilliance of the "Scherzo" and cumulative energy of the finale are really made to tell. Barbirolli gives marvellously understanding support here and in Sea Pictures. It also established its soloist--Janet Baker and remains the deepest and most perceptive recording this song-cycle is ever likely to have! Baker makes light of the sometimes gauche poetry and awkward word-setting, giving the music a sweep and nobility typical of Elgar at his best. --Richard Whitehouse

CELLO CONCERTO
As a student I was privilleged to see a perfomance of the Elgar given by Ms. Du Pre, and over the decades scince I have owned a copy of this wonderful account of the Cello Concerto. One could try and compare recordings, for instance I treasure performances by Pini, Casals and Tortelier, to name but three!! Ultimately I find I return again and again to this particular performance, masterfully accompanied by Sir John Barbirolli. This Concerto, written when it was, is the essence of Elgar.
